A city council is typically referred to as a "city council" in many municipalities. However, it may also be known by other names, such as a "town council," "borough council," or "municipal council," depending on the specific governance structure and terminology used in different regions or countries. The council is responsible for making local laws, setting budgets, and addressing community issues.

What is a city councilmember?

In a city or municipality, the governing body is typically a group of officials who are citizens residing in that city, and represent areas or districts within the city. They are either elected or appointed. This group of elected or appointed officials is typically called a city council. In most cities, a mayor is the highest official, and depending on local laws, may preside over the city council. Individual members of this council are called city council members.
